An Advanced Certificate in Self-Harm Identification and Response equips professionals with the crucial skills to recognize, understand, and respond effectively to self-harm behaviors. This specialized training goes beyond basic awareness, delving into the complexities of self-harm and its underlying causes.
Learning outcomes include mastering techniques for identifying self-harm indicators, understanding risk assessment protocols, and developing effective intervention strategies. Participants will also gain proficiency in providing compassionate support and connecting individuals to appropriate mental health resources. Crisis management and ethical considerations are integral components of the program.
The duration of the Advanced Certificate varies depending on the provider but typically ranges from several weeks to several months of part-time or full-time study. This flexible approach accommodates professionals with varying schedules while ensuring thorough coverage of the curriculum. Many programs incorporate interactive online modules, case studies, and practical exercises for comprehensive learning.
